
These warmly spiced cookies are the kind of treat that fills your kitchen with the most incredible aroma — deep molasses, bright ginger, and a hint of earthy turmeric all coming together in one irresistible bite. Cassava flour gives them a tender, slightly chewy texture that holds up beautifully to rolling and cutting, making them just as fun to shape as they are to eat. Blackstrap molasses and maple syrup bring a rich, complex sweetness, while Ceylon cinnamon keeps the spice profile smooth and not overpowering. Every single ingredient here is plant-based and naturally free from any animal-derived or pork-derived additives — no gelatin, no lard, no hidden surprises — so you can bake with total confidence. The apple cider vinegar works quietly in the background, reacting with the baking soda to give the cookies just enough lift without any eggs in sight. Chilling the dough before rolling is the key step that keeps everything clean and workable, so don't skip it. These are the kind of cookies that disappear fast, so consider doubling the batch.

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the cassava flour, arrowroot starch, baking soda, ground ginger, ground Ceylon cinnamon, turmeric, and sea salt until evenly combined.
In a medium mixing bowl, whisk together the melted coconut oil, molasses, maple syrup, apple cider vinegar, and vanilla powder until smooth and fully incorporated.
